The forum will be take place on 14-15 September, in-person at the Fiona Stanley Hospital (Perth, WA), and online. The forum will provide opportunities for connection, knowledge sharing, learning and upskilling for all attendees.

The theme of this year’s forum is “Empowering action for sustainable, climate resilient healthcare.” The world is striving for a low carbon, sustainable and climate resilient future – and healthcare delivery must change alongside it. It’s evident we need to act – but how do we actually drive the shifts in our healthcare system we need to bring about change? How do we engage our decision makers, suppliers, our colleagues and our patients in the process? How do we overcome barriers to progress?

Our forum will be focused on the ‘how’ – how do we empower action to deliver sustainable and climate resilient healthcare?

A diverse line-up of speakers, from healthcare, government, industry partners, academia and beyond, will share their expertise on current research, policy, industry innovations and practical examples of sustainable healthcare in action.
